Size

Refrigerators with integrated fridge freezers are designed to be installed directly into your cabinetry. They're usually smaller than freestanding models. They're an ideal choice if looking for a sleek, modern appliance that can blend with your cabinetry and counters. They're also a great choice when you don't have space in your home for a separate freezer.

When choosing an integrated refrigerator freezer, you must take into consideration some things. For one, they tend to be more expensive than freestanding models. This is because of the extra costs associated with buying and installing a refrigerator cabinet, kitchen cabinet door, and a bridging cabinet to connect the refrigerator.

Another aspect to be aware of is that fridge freezers integrated can be difficult to service. This is because the refrigerator has to be removed from its housing cabinet and the doors for kitchen cabinets must be re-hung, which can take months or even weeks. It is therefore essential to find an experienced kitchen fitter who will be able to do the job right.

If you are considering buying a new integrated fridge freezer it is essential to take a careful measurement of the space before purchasing it. Make sure to leave some space on either side of the appliance so that you can open the doors. It's also recommended to take a look at the door hinges of the refrigerator. A lot of cheap models have hinges that aren't built to support the weight of a fridge and tend to fail after a couple of years.

Refrigerators with integrated freezers are available in a range of widths, which can assist you in maximizing storage. The depth of the fridge can also affect your kitchen cabinets. For instance, if you're planning to install tall cabinets above the refrigerator, then you may have to order the appliance in a custom-length to ensure it is suitable. Verify that the ventilation in the refrigerator has been cut in the correct way. If it's not, you could face problems in the future.

Style

It is important to take into consideration a number of factors before making a decision. Freestanding fridge freezers are preferred because they're heavy and can dominate the space. The integrated models are more sleek and seamless and blend into the cabinets.

They are typically in a flush position with the cabinetry and counters with their doors set so they don't protrude. They are often panel-ready to give a more streamlined finish to your kitchen. Many also come with stainless steel fronts that give them an elegant and contemporary appearance.

The freezer compartment is quite big, and is usually in the lower part of the freezer to give you plenty of space for your frozen meals. There are a variety of width sizes available. The majority of brands offer between 20-24 inch widths which is more than freestanding freezers.

Integrated refrigerators are more expensive because of their design, and they are also built within your kitchen. This is due to the cost of a fridge housing cabinet and kitchen cabinets that make the surround will increase the overall cost.

They can be more difficult to move should you plan to move home which may be an issue for some people. It is necessary to remove the entire unit and cabinetry. It's not as easy as unplugging the appliance, then removing it like with an independent one.

The integrated fridges are also more difficult to repair because they are installed inside your existing kitchen. If you encounter an issue, you'll need a fridge engineer to disassemble and replace any damaged components. This can be a costly process and is definitely more expensive than buying an entirely new fridge freezer as a replacement.

Storage

The primary benefit of integrated fridge freezers is that they consume less space than freestanding models, allowing you make the most of your kitchen. They can also be flush with cabinets and counters, creating a seamless look. This design, however, implies they have a smaller capacity of storage than freestanding models.

What's more, they're often more expensive to buy and operate than freestanding fridge freezers with the same specifications. This is down to a variety of factors including the cost of development and manufacturing and the fact that they're regarded a luxury product, and the additional costs for installation and customization that they incur.


It is also more difficult to maintain integrated fridge freezers than freestanding counterparts. This is particularly true if you purchase an integrated refrigerator freezer that isn't worth the cost with poorly-made hinges that can break in time.

The size of your family and your storage requirements will determine the most efficient integrated fridge freezer. You should also think about how much food you will be storing in your fridge, and whether you'll be stocking large platters or frozen food items. The majority of integrated fridge freezers have storage capacities of between 150 and 350 litres. This will allow you to store 19 shopping bags.

The most efficient refrigerator freezers have features that keep your food fresh and healthy. For example, some will feature airflow technology which circulates cool air throughout shelves, while some will include an antibacterial lining that will reduce odours and prevent mould. Some models even come with an option for fast-freezing that quickly reduces the temperature of your freezer, meaning you can freeze freshly-bought goods without them forming a solid.

If you want to keep your meat, fish, and dairy products at a certain temperature, then you should look for refrigerators with integrated freezers that have a BioFresh section. These compartments are kept at a lower level of humidity and will keep your fish, meat and dairy fresher longer than a typical fridge freezer. In addition, vegetables and fruits can be kept fresher for longer in a HydroSafe compartment that is maintained at a higher humidity.
